本文整理汇总了Python中u.load函数的典型用法代码示例。如果您正苦于以下问题:Python load函数的具体用法?Python load怎么用?Python load使用的例子?那么恭喜您, 这里精选的函数代码示例或许可以为您提供帮助。
在下文中一共展示了load函数的20个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于我们的系统推荐出更棒的Python代码示例。
示例1: testBackJoinElements
def testBackJoinElements():
sp = u.load()
sp.cmd("moveDown")
sp.cmd("deleteBackward")
assert (sp.line == 0) and (sp.column == 23)
assert sp.lines[0].text == "ext. stonehenge - nightA blizzard rages."\
" Snow is everywhere"
开发者ID:millingjon,项目名称:scrupulous,代码行数:7,代码来源:delete.py
示例2: testMoveUp
def testMoveUp():
sp = u.load()
sp.cmd("moveUp")
assert (sp.line == 0) and (sp.column == 0)
sp.cmd("moveDown")
sp.cmd("moveLineEnd")
sp.cmd("moveUp")
assert (sp.line == 0) and (sp.column == 23)
开发者ID:4thguy,项目名称:trelby,代码行数:8,代码来源:movement.py
示例3: testBackLbForced
def testBackLbForced():
sp = u.load()
sp.gotoPos(34, 0)
assert sp.lines[33].lb == scr.LB_FORCED
sp.cmd("deleteBackward")
assert (sp.line == 33) and (sp.column == 6)
assert sp.lines[33].text == "brightyellow package at their feet."
assert sp.lines[33].lb == scr.LB_LAST
开发者ID:millingjon,项目名称:scrupulous,代码行数:9,代码来源:delete.py
示例4: testMoveLeft
def testMoveLeft():
sp = u.load()
sp.cmd("moveLeft")
assert (sp.line == 0) and (sp.column == 0)
sp.cmd("moveDown")
sp.cmd("moveLeft")
assert (sp.line == 0) and (sp.column == 23)
sp.cmd("moveLineStart")
assert sp.column == 0
开发者ID:4thguy,项目名称:trelby,代码行数:9,代码来源:movement.py
示例5: testBasic
def testBasic():
sp = u.load()
report = characterreport.CharacterReport(sp)
data = report.generate()
# try to catch cases where generate returns something other than a PDF
# document
assert len(data) > 200
assert data[:8] == "%PDF-1.5"
开发者ID:G33kX,项目名称:trelby,代码行数:9,代码来源:t_characterreport.py
示例6: testBasic
def testBasic():
sp = u.load()
sp.cmd("setMark")
sp.getSelectedAsCD(True)
assert sp.lines[0].lb == scr.LB_LAST
assert sp.lines[0].lt == scr.SCENE
assert sp.lines[0].text == "xt. stonehenge - night"
开发者ID:4thguy,项目名称:trelby,代码行数:9,代码来源:cut.py
示例7: testBasic
def testBasic():
sp = u.load()
report = locationreport.LocationReport(scenereport.SceneReport(sp))
data = report.generate()
# try to catch cases where generate returns something other than a PDF
# document
assert len(data) > 200
assert data[:8] == "%PDF-1.5"
开发者ID:4thguy,项目名称:trelby,代码行数:9,代码来源:t_locationreport.py
示例8: testMoveSceneDown
def testMoveSceneDown():
sp = u.load()
sp.cmd("moveSceneDown")
assert (sp.line == 14) and (sp.column == 0)
sp.cmd("moveDown")
sp.cmd("moveSceneDown")
assert (sp.line == 30) and (sp.column == 0)
sp.cmd("moveEnd")
sp.cmd("moveSceneDown")
assert (sp.line == 158) and (sp.column == 0)
开发者ID:4thguy,项目名称:trelby,代码行数:10,代码来源:movement.py
示例9: testBackLbForcedTypeConvert
def testBackLbForcedTypeConvert():
sp = u.load()
sp.cmd("toTransition")
sp.cmd("moveDown", count=3)
sp.cmd("insertForcedLineBreak")
sp.cmd("moveUp")
sp.cmd("deleteBackward")
sp._validate()
开发者ID:millingjon,项目名称:scrupulous,代码行数:10,代码来源:delete.py
示例10: testMoveRight
def testMoveRight():
sp = u.load()
sp.cmd("moveRight")
assert sp.column == 1
sp.cmd("moveLineEnd")
sp.cmd("moveRight")
assert (sp.line == 1) and (sp.column == 0)
sp.cmd("moveEnd")
sp.cmd("moveRight")
assert (sp.line == 158) and (sp.column == 5)
开发者ID:4thguy,项目名称:trelby,代码行数:10,代码来源:movement.py
示例11: testNbspAtEOL
def testNbspAtEOL():
sp = u.load()
sp.cmd("moveDown", count = 3)
sp.cmd("moveLineEnd")
sp.cmd("addChar", char = chr(160))
sp.cmd("addChar", char = "a")
assert sp.lines[3].text.endswith("mind")
assert sp.lines[4].text.startswith("would%sa" % chr(160))
assert (sp.line == 4) and (sp.column == 7)
assert sp.lines[3].lb == scr.LB_SPACE
assert sp.lines[4].lb == scr.LB_LAST
开发者ID:4thguy,项目名称:trelby,代码行数:11,代码来源:addchar.py
示例12: testForcedLb
def testForcedLb():
sp = u.load()
sp.cmd("moveDown", count = 2)
sp.cmd("insertForcedLineBreak")
sp.cmd("moveUp", count = 2)
sp.cmd("moveLineEnd")
sp.cmd("setMark")
sp.cmd("moveRight")
sp.getSelectedAsCD(True)
sp._validate()
开发者ID:4thguy,项目名称:trelby,代码行数:11,代码来源:cut.py
示例13: testMoveDown
def testMoveDown():
sp = u.load()
sp.cmd("moveDown")
assert sp.line == 1
sp.cmd("moveDown")
sp.cmd("moveDown")
sp.cmd("moveLineEnd")
sp.cmd("moveDown")
assert (sp.line == 4) and (sp.column == 31)
sp.cmd("moveEnd")
sp.cmd("moveDown")
assert sp.line == 158
开发者ID:4thguy,项目名称:trelby,代码行数:12,代码来源:movement.py
示例14: testLastDelete
def testLastDelete():
sp = u.load()
sp.cmd("moveEnd")
sp.cmd("setMark")
sp.cmd("moveUp", count = 4)
sp.cmd("moveLineStart")
# we used to have a bug where if we deleted e.g. the last two lines of
# the script, and that element was longer, we didn't mark the
# third-last line as LB_LAST, and then it crashed in rewrapPara.
sp.getSelectedAsCD(True)
开发者ID:4thguy,项目名称:trelby,代码行数:12,代码来源:cut.py
示例15: run
def run(self, sp):
if self.name == "NEW":
return u.new()
elif self.name == "LOAD":
return u.load()
if self.args:
sp.cmd(self.name, chr(self.args[0]))
else:
sp.cmd(self.name)
return sp
开发者ID:cowmix,项目名称:trelby,代码行数:12,代码来源:t_random.py
示例16: testTypeConvert
def testTypeConvert():
sp = u.load()
sp.cmd("toTransition")
sp.cmd("moveDown", count = 3)
sp.cmd("insertForcedLineBreak")
sp.cmd("moveUp")
sp.cmd("setMark")
sp.cmd("moveLeft")
sp.getSelectedAsCD(True)
sp._validate()
开发者ID:4thguy,项目名称:trelby,代码行数:12,代码来源:cut.py
示例17: testBackLbSpace
def testBackLbSpace():
sp = u.load()
sp.gotoPos(16, 60)
sp.cmd("addChar", char=" ")
assert sp.lines[16].lb == scr.LB_SPACE
sp.cmd("moveDown")
sp.cmd("moveLineStart")
sp.cmd("deleteBackward")
assert (sp.line == 17) and (sp.column == 0)
assert sp.lines[16].lb == scr.LB_SPACE
assert sp.lines[16].text == "A calm night, with the ocean almost still."\
" Two fishermen are"
assert sp.lines[17].text == "smoking at the rear deck."
开发者ID:millingjon,项目名称:scrupulous,代码行数:13,代码来源:delete.py
示例18: testSpaceAtEOL
def testSpaceAtEOL():
sp = u.load()
sp.cmd("moveDown", count = 3)
sp.cmd("moveLineEnd")
sp.cmd("addChar", char = "z")
sp.cmd("addChar", char = " ")
assert sp.lines[3].text.endswith("z ")
sp.cmd("addChar", char = "x")
assert (sp.line == 4) and (sp.column == 1)
assert sp.lines[3].lb == scr.LB_SPACE
assert sp.lines[4].lb == scr.LB_LAST
assert sp.lines[3].text.endswith("wouldz")
assert sp.lines[4].text.startswith("x be")
开发者ID:4thguy,项目名称:trelby,代码行数:13,代码来源:addchar.py
示例19: testMoveSceneUp
def testMoveSceneUp():
sp = u.load()
sp.cmd("moveSceneUp")
assert (sp.line == 0) and (sp.column == 0)
sp.gotoPos(18, 1)
sp.cmd("moveSceneUp")
assert (sp.line == 14) and (sp.column == 0)
sp.cmd("moveSceneUp")
assert (sp.line == 0) and (sp.column == 0)
# make sure we don't go before the start trying to find scenes
sp.cmd("toAction")
sp.cmd("moveSceneUp")
assert (sp.line == 0) and (sp.column == 0)
开发者ID:4thguy,项目名称:trelby,代码行数:14,代码来源:movement.py
示例20: testEndPrevPara
def testEndPrevPara():
sp = u.load()
sp.cmd("moveDown", count = 4)
sp.cmd("moveLineEnd")
sp.cmd("setMark")
sp.cmd("moveLineStart")
sp.cmd("moveUp")
sp.getSelectedAsCD(True)
# test that when deleting the last lines of an element we correctly
# flag the preceding line as the new last line.
assert sp.lines[2].lb == scr.LB_LAST
assert sp.lines[3].lt == scr.CHARACTER
开发者ID:4thguy,项目名称:trelby,代码行数:16,代码来源:cut.py
注:本文中的u.load函数示例由纯净天空整理自Github/MSDocs等源码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。 |
请发表评论